aboutsummaryrefslogtreecommitdiff
path: root/conanfile.py
diff options
context:
space:
mode:
authorrtk0c <[email protected]>2023-06-15 18:13:43 -0700
committerrtk0c <[email protected]>2023-06-15 18:13:43 -0700
commit434a274cc8b85cfb37309c0ac1b1470ed930d30f (patch)
tree7c58e71906f5476ff6d103a1f696857915c8394c /conanfile.py
parenta55e98b68735f1e4152a01773f22d28c472138ab (diff)
Changeset: 97 Migreate to conan2
Diffstat (limited to 'conanfile.py')
-rw-r--r--conanfile.py28
1 files changed, 28 insertions, 0 deletions
diff --git a/conanfile.py b/conanfile.py
new file mode 100644
index 0000000..65ae0dc
--- /dev/null
+++ b/conanfile.py
@@ -0,0 +1,28 @@
+from conan import ConanFile
+
+class ProjectBrussel(ConanFile):
+ settings = "os", "compiler", "build_type", "arch"
+ generators = "CMakeDeps", "CMakeToolchain"
+ default_options = {
+ "glad/*:no_loader": True,
+ "glad/*:gl_version": "4.5",
+ }
+
+ def requirements(self):
+ self.requires("cxxopts/3.1.1")
+
+ self.requires("robin-hood-hashing/3.11.5")
+ self.requires("frozen/1.1.1")
+ self.requires("sqlite3/3.42.0")
+
+ self.requires("pcg-cpp/cci.20220409")
+
+ self.requires("fmt/9.1.0")
+ self.requires("spdlog/1.11.0")
+
+ self.requires("rapidjson/cci.20220822", override=True)
+ self.requires("json_dto/0.3.1")
+
+ self.requires("glad/0.1.34")
+ self.requires("stb/cci.20220909")
+ # self.requires("assimp/5.2.2")